""" This script processes all multiplication JSONL files in: /weka/oe-adapt-default/nouhad/data/multiplication/ Usage: python scripts/data/rlvr/open_reasoner.py --push_to_hub python scripts/data/rlvr/open_reasoner.py --push_to_hub --hf_entity ai2-adapt-dev """ from collections import defaultdict from dataclasses import dataclass import os import json from typing import Optional import datasets from huggingface_hub import HfApi from huggingface_hub.repocard import RepoCard from transformers import HfArgumentParser @dataclass class Args: push_to_hub: bool = False hf_entity: Optional[str] = None def process_file(file_path: str): """ Processes a single JSONL file into a dataset. """ print(f"Processing file: {file_path}") with open(file_path, "r") as f: data = f.readlines() new_data = [] for item in data: item = item.strip() # Remove extra spaces or newline characters if not item: # Skip empty lines continue new_data.append(json.loads(item)) # Convert JSON string to Python dict table = defaultdict(list) for item in new_data: assert "problem" in item and "answer" in item, "Missing expected keys in data" table["messages"].append([ {"role": "user", "content": item["problem"]}, {"role": "assistant", "content": item["answer"]}, ]) table["ground_truth"].append(item["answer"]) table["dataset"].append("multiplication") return datasets.Dataset.from_dict(table) def main(args: Args): data_dir = "/weka/oe-adapt-default/nouhad/data/multiplication/" jsonl_files = [os.path.join(data_dir, f) for f in os.listdir(data_dir) if f.endswith(".jsonl")] if not jsonl_files: print(f"No JSONL files found in {data_dir}") return api = HfApi() hf_entity = args.hf_entity if args.hf_entity else api.whoami()["name"] for file_path in jsonl_files: dataset = process_file(file_path) dataset_name = os.path.basename(file_path).replace(".jsonl", "") if args.push_to_hub: repo_id = f"{hf_entity}/{dataset_name}" print(f"Pushing dataset to Hub: {repo_id}") dataset.push_to_hub(repo_id) api.upload_file( path_or_fileobj=__file__, path_in_repo="create_dataset.py", repo_type="dataset", repo_id=repo_id, ) # Add RepoCard repo_card = RepoCard( content=f"""\ # Multiplication Dataset - {dataset_name} This dataset contains multiplication problems and their solutions. ## Dataset Format - `messages`: List of message dictionaries with user questions and assistant answers - `ground_truth`: The correct solution for each problem - `dataset`: Always "multiplication" to indicate its type """ ) repo_card.push_to_hub( repo_id, repo_type="dataset", ) if __name__ == "__main__": parser = HfArgumentParser((Args,)) main(*parser.parse_args_into_dataclasses())
